Runbook: Sensor drift on GreenLoft controllers

If humidity readings in a GreenLoft bay creep more than 5% off the reference probe, it's almost always sensor drift, not a real climate change. Don't recalibrate in place — swap the probe and flag the old one for bench testing. Tomas keeps spares in the east shed. Step-by-step recalibration instructions are on the internal page below:

wiki page, yajep-fajog: https://confluence.torvahq.local/ticket/display/dash/settings/merge_requests/ticket/run/a3215cc5a3d8263468d4c885

CHANGELOG — ScrubPix 3.4.0. Renamed setting: EXIF_STRIP_MODE is now SCRUB_POLICY to cover XMP and IPTC removal as well. Old name accepted until 3.6 with a deprecation warning. The scrub worker also now requires its signing credential at boot rather than lazily. Set it in the worker env file with this line:

env line for fafof-fahag: LEDGER_TOKEN5=f8790

## BounceHound Runbook — Getting Oriented

Welcome aboard! BounceHound chews through bounce notifications from our outbound mail and sorts them into soft, hard, and "weird" buckets. If the queue backs up past an hour, suppression lists go stale and marketing gets cranky, so keep an eye on lag. Most fixes are just a restart with sane settings. When restarting, make sure the service comes up with these configuration values:

service settings:
[briius]
port = 3000
region = outer-1
host = briius.zarqeldyn.internal
team = wenael
timeout_ms = 2000
retries = 5

**Ticket #4412 — Expired creds blocking relevance tuning sandbox**

Hey plugin folks — the sandbox token for the Quillsort relevance tuner expired over the weekend, so any boost-weight experiments you pushed since Friday probably failed silently. Sorry about that. The synonym-expansion and recency-decay knobs are unaffected, but re-run your eval suites once you swap creds. We've minted a fresh key scoped to the tuning API only, so don't try hitting the indexer with it. New key for the sandbox is below.

API key for yahig-tadup: kto7_ubizbYm